Effective readers don’t just passively read—they monitor their understanding and clarify when something doesn’t make sense. Teaching students strategies for monitoring comprehension helps them:
- Identify when they don’t understand a word, phrase, or idea.
- Use context clues, re-reading, and questioning to clarify meaning.
- Build confidence in independently tackling challenging texts.
